Trump suspended military aid to Ukraine

US President Donald Trump has ordered a suspension of military assistance to Ukraine, according to the American media representative.

“The President clearly stated that it is focused on peace. We want our partners to be faithful to this goal. We stop and review our help to make sure that it contributes to this goal, “the statement said.

The White House official stressed that this order will remain in force as long as President Trump is not convinced that Ukraine is committed to peace.

The New York Times notes that the supplies of more than a billion dollars will be stopped and their production orders.

Earlier, the US media reported that Trump is preparing for a special meeting with key officials of his administration on Ukraine, during which the issue of freezing or suspending American aid may be discussed.

Yesterday, the US President criticized the Ukrainian leader who stated that Russia’s war could still go on for a long time.

“This is the worst statement that Zelensky could do, America will not tolerate this again,” Trump wrote on Truth Social.
